  • Patent number: 4685840
    Abstract: A method of transporting large diameter solids, such as coal having a diameter of greater than 1 inch, preferably eight to twelve inches, predicated on pipe diameter, in the form of a slurry through a pipeline is disclosed. The method comprises the step of placing large diameter solids in a vehicle and pumping it through a pipeline. The specific gravity of the vehicle is substantially equal to the specific gravity of the solids so that the coal remains in suspension over a wide range of pipeline velocities. A lubricant is added to the vehicle to reduce friction and enhance energy efficiency of the process. The coal is pumped from a pumping tank into which the solids and vehicle are introduced, the pumping tank, after filling, is pressurized with a fluid such as air or inert gas to propel the mixture through the pipeline. This pump and its valving allows large diameter solids to be pumped through the pipeline.

  • Patent number: 4485843
    Abstract: The present invention provides a pressure relief valve having a broad range of variable relief pressures. The valve has an inlet passage, an outlet passage, a valve seat interposed between said passages, a valving member mounted for movement into and out of sealing engagement with the valve seat, a valve stem assembly operably connected to said valving member, and two or more resilient compression springs of preferably variable length mounted relative to said valve stem to exert a progressively greater compressive force upon said valve stem upon compression of said valve springs, and an adjustable pressure plate assembly for pre-compressing of the compression springs so as to set the relief pressure at a desired pressure value. A preferred embodiment is directed to that comprising a valve stem assembly for preventing the valve spring from being compressed beyond a predetermined selected point of relief pressure.

  • Patent number: 4418805
    Abstract: The present invention provides unique hinge means comprising three components, two of which are wedge shaped members or segments which slidably pivot relative to each other about a central pivot point and the third being a base bracket pivotably attached to the center wedge whereby the two wedge members fan open relative to the base bracket in operational sequence.The present hinge finds particular application for use in a solid rigid suitcase and which is adapted for retaining garments in a full length arrangement. The present suitcase comprises two halves operably connected along their bottom portions by opposing pairs of expanding hinges positioned at each end.

  • Patent number: 4384704
    Abstract: The present invention provides a cargo valve mounted upon a horizontal bulkhead having a discharge opening. A vertically disposed preferably cylindrical valve housing is mounted on the bulkhead above the opening and a plurality of support plates mounted at their respective end portions to the bulkhead and to the valve body. The plates support the body a distance above the opening allowing fluid of slurry flow to enter the discharge opening between the bulkhead and the valve body. A preferably cylindrical valve piston is slidably mounted within the valve body housing between upper open and lower closed positions. The valve piston provides a lower preferably circular valve seat conforming to the circular discharge opening which has a diameter preferably greater than the diameter of the opening which allows for the sealing thereof. A seal is provided at the lower circular edge of the seat and forms a closure of the discharge opening when the valve piston is in its lower closed position.

  • Patent number: 4336763
    Abstract: An automatic pneumatic pumping system of the type using two or more pumping tanks which are filled in alternate sequence with liquid from a common source and are alternately purged by air pressure so as to effect a continuous and uninterrupted flow of the liquid into a common discharge line, wherein exhaust pumping air is used to create additional head within the liquid supply tanks and the creation of vacuum is used for system and auxiliary use. A preferred application of the system to marine vessels, for example a barge, is described (FIGS. 2-5), along with two special valves, a cargo valve of "top hat" design (FIG. 6) and a cargo inlet feed valve of a two-port wafer type (FIGS. 7A-C).

  • Patent number: 4328831
    Abstract: A rotary valve apparatus having particular utility to the valving of high solids content fluids such as slurries and the like provides a normally fixed, generally flat circular disk defining a valve body and providing a plurality of radially spaced flow openings and an open center. A generally flat valving member is mounted in face-to-face engagement with the disk and is movable with respect to the disk between open and closed positions. The valving member provides a hub with a shaft opening therethrough and a plurality of radially projecting valving members which align with and cover the flow openings in the closed position. A common shaft penetrates the open center and the shaft opening and affixes at one thereof to the valving member for rotation therewith. The common shaft is generally coincident with the central axis of the valve body and is entirely disposed within the fluid flow stream being valved.
